A canoe in still water travels at a rate of 12 miles per hour. The current today is traveling at a rate of 2 miles per hour. If
VARVARA [1.3K]

Answer:

It’s 60miles

Step-by-step explanation:

We assume the trip is "d" miles and that the "extra hour" refers to the additional time that a current of 2 mph would add. That is, we assume the reference time is for a current of 0 mph.

The time with no current is ...

 time1 = distance/speed

 time1 = d/12 . . . . hours

With a current of 2 mph in the opposite direction, the time is ...

 time2 = d/(12 -2) = d/10

The second time is 1 hour longer than the first, so we have ...

 time2 = 1 + time1

 d/10 = 1 + d/12

 6d = 60 + 5d . . . . multiply by 60

 d = 60 . . . . . . . . . subtract 5d

The one-way distance is 60 miles.

<h3>What is a tax bracket?</h3>

Tax brackets are a series of income and tax layers by which people are defined based on how much they earn per annum.

The tax rates range from 10% to 37%. The rate applicable to a person or group of persons depends on

  • whether or not they are single
  • If married, whether they are filing jointly; and
  • how much their annual income is subject to deductibles.
